The Adeptus Astartes: The Masters of Versatility

The Adeptus Astartes, more commonly known as the Space Marines, are the poster boys of Warhammer 40K. These genetically enhanced super soldiers are renowned for their adaptability and versatility. With various chapters to choose from, each with its own unique traits and playstyles, the Adeptus Astartes offer a wide range of options for players.

The Space Marine army is known for its flexibility, with units that can excel in multiple combat scenarios. Whether you need heavy firepower, close combat prowess, or tactical flexibility, the Adeptus Astartes have you covered. From the versatile Tactical Squads to the devastating firepower of Devastator Squads, the Space Marines can adapt to any situation.

The T’au Empire: Mastering the Art of Adaptation

In the grim darkness of the Warhammer 40K universe, the T’au Empire stands out as a faction that excels at adaptation and innovation. Led by the ethereal caste, the T’au embrace the philosophy of the Greater Good, seeking to unite the galaxy under their rule. Their units reflect this mindset, with a focus on advanced technology and combined arms tactics.

The T’au Empire offers a unique playstyle that emphasizes long-range firepower and rapid maneuverability. Their battlesuits, such as the iconic Crisis Suits, are highly versatile and can be equipped with a wide range of weapons to suit different battlefield scenarios. This adaptability allows T’au players to engage enemies at a distance or close quarters, depending on the situation.

Strategies and Tips for T’au Empire Players

To make the most of the T’au Empire’s adaptability, players should consider a few key strategies and tips. Firstly, prioritizing target selection is crucial. The T’au Empire’s ranged firepower can be devastating, but it’s important to focus on eliminating high-value targets first. This will disrupt your opponent’s strategy and give you an advantage in the long run.

Another tip for T’au Empire players is to make use of their mobility. Battlesuits equipped with Jump Packs or Jetpacks can quickly reposition themselves on the battlefield, allowing for tactical advantages. By utilizing hit-and-run tactics or flanking maneuvers, T’au players can keep their opponents off balance and gain the upper hand.

4. Can any faction match the adaptability of the Necrons?

The Necrons are a faction known for their resilience and technological prowess. While they may not have the same level of adaptability as some other factions, their units are highly durable and capable of self-repair. The Necrons’ ability to reanimate fallen warriors and teleport across the battlefield gives them a unique edge in terms of tactical flexibility. However, their playstyle is more focused on outlasting the enemy rather than adapting to different situations.

5. Are there any factions with units that can adapt during the course of a battle?

Yes, the Genestealer Cults are a faction that excels at adaptability during the course of a battle. These secretive cults infiltrate human societies and rise up in rebellion when the time is right. Their units have the ability to deploy hidden and then emerge at a critical moment, catching their opponents off guard. This surprise element allows the Genestealer Cults to adapt their units’ positioning and strategy as the battle unfolds, making them a highly unpredictable force.

Additionally, the Orks are known for their ability to adapt and improvise. Ork units, fueled by their collective belief in the power of their technology, can sometimes exhibit unexpected abilities or even change their behavior based on the whims of their Warboss. This unpredictability can make Ork units adaptable in a more chaotic and spontaneous manner.
